gnu: dbus: Replace with 1.10.12 [security fix].
Fixes <https://bugs.freedesktop.org/show_bug.cgi?id=98157> "format string vulnerability processing ActivationFailure messages" * gnu/packages/glib.scm (dbus)[replacement]: New field. (dbus-1.10.12): New variable.master
parent
c62a31ca80
commit
90dcd49663
|
@ -64,6 +64,7 @@
|
|||
(define dbus
|
||||
(package
|
||||
(name "dbus")
|
||||
(replacement dbus-1.10.12)
|
||||
(version "1.10.10")
|
||||
(source (origin
|
||||
(method url-fetch)
|
||||
|
@ -131,6 +132,21 @@ or through unencrypted TCP/IP suitable for use behind a firewall with
|
|||
shared NFS home directories.")
|
||||
(license license:gpl2+))) ; or Academic Free License 2.1
|
||||
|
||||
(define dbus-1.10.12
|
||||
(package
|
||||
(inherit dbus)
|
||||
(name "dbus")
|
||||
(source
|
||||
(let ((version "1.10.12"))
|
||||
(origin
|
||||
(method url-fetch)
|
||||
(uri (string-append
|
||||
"https://dbus.freedesktop.org/releases/dbus/dbus-"
|
||||
version ".tar.gz"))
|
||||
(sha256
|
||||
(base32
|
||||
"0pa71vf5c0d7k3gni06iascmplj0j5g70wbc833ayvi71d1pj2i1")))))))
|
||||
|
||||
(define glib
|
||||
(package
|
||||
(name "glib")
|
||||
|
|
Reference in New Issue